Automatic Address Setting (ASET) is a special install and commissioning mode that can be activated on a per
loop basis whilst in INSTALLATION mode. ASET mode is only required if Soft Addressable Modules (SAM's) are
used in the fire protection system. Soft Addressable Modules (SAM's) do not have their addresses set using
switches. They automatically assign their own addresses and ASET mode is used to achieve this.
Because ASET mode requires manual triggering of each device (using the standard test procedure for each one) the
installer can effectively choose the address for each detector and simultaneously program and test each device.
SAM'S CAN BE MIXED WITH OTHER TYPES OF DEVICES ON THE SAME LOOP. Each time a SAM is programmed it takes
the next free address on its loop.
SAM's can only be used in conjunction with the following Wizmart Protocol panels:
a) Juno Net
b) Junior
c) Sub panel (incorporating SIMM module & socket).
Before starting the programming procedure, care should be taken with the following:
a) Supply OK.
b) Auxiliary Supply (Batteries) OK.
c) Loop Supply OK.
d) Verify the non-existence of earth current leakage.
e) Verify the cable lengths for the loop.
f ) Confirm the non-existence of short or open circuits within the loop.
g) Verify communications with standard analogue addressable devices is OK.
h) Verify communications between Panel, and Repeaters with integrated Sub-Panel.
Verify that all SAM connections, both to the loop and the associated conventional device (i.e. smoke sensor/
detector, call point, etc.) are properly made and that the conventional device connections follow the
manufacturer's instructions, in particular those regarding polarity. Reversal of the supply polarity can cause failure
or malfunction and prevent a SAM from being programmed.
NOTE:
Verify panel software version by looking at number on the sticker placed on the SIMM card.
SAM's cannot operate or be programmed when installed within loops associated with old
Sub-Panel versions (i.e. that do not include a SIMM card and socket).
CAUTION
Reset to normal operation all devices before applying power to the panel, in
particular manual call points
Verify that there are no faults or fire conditions in the loop or system.
Clear all fault and fire conditions first.
